What is Quartzite? 

Quartzite is a strong, natural stone that's often used in kitchens and bathrooms. It handles heat, doesn't scratch easily, and holds up well over time. People like it because it has a clean, natural look that works in both modern and classic spaces. Some styles look a bit like marble but don't need as much care. That's why Quartzite Countertops are a practical pick that still feels high-end.  

How is Quartzite Formed? 

Quartzite forms when sandstone gets pushed deep under the Earth's surface. With enough heat and pressure over time, that sandstone hardens. The grains fuse and turn into a much tougher stone. This is what gives Quartzite Stone its solid feel and durability.  

What Color is Taj Mahal Quartzite?  

Taj Mahal Quartzite usually has a light beige or off-white background. You'll see gentle veins in gray, gold, or tan running through it. The pattern isn't loud, so it works with many styles. Some pieces look warmer, while others lean a bit cooler. This makes it easy to match cabinets and floors. It has a clean look, kind of like marble, but needs less care.  

Is Quartzite Stronger than Granite? 

Yes, quartzite is generally considered to be stronger and more durable than granite. While both are very strong, quartzite typically scores higher on the Mohs scale of mineral hardness, making it more resistant to scratches and abrasions than granite.

What Makes Quartzite Stand Out for Kitchen Countertops? 

Natural Stone with unmatched beauty

Quartzite stands out due to its beauty. Every piece looks different. Some slabs have soft, flowing lines. Others show stronger veins and contrast. You won't get that kind of detail from synthetic surfaces. It's real, and it shows. Whether the design is warm or cool, Quartzite Countertops bring in texture, depth, and a kind of quiet style that holds attention without trying too hard. 

Tougher than granite, resistant to heat and scratches  

Quartzite isn't just good-looking, it's strong. It's harder than granite. That means it holds up better against cuts, drops, and general wear. You can set hot pans on it without worrying. Scratches don't show up easily, either. It's the kind of surface that works for people who use their kitchens, not just decorating them. That's why Quartzite Countertops have become a smart pick, especially in homes where cooking happens daily and surfaces take a beating.

Mont Blanc Quartzite 

Mont Blanc Quartzite has a soft gray base with thin, smoky veins running through it. A lot of people choose it when they want something neutral that still has a character. It fits well with white, black, or wood cabinets. Nothing about it feels overdone. These Quartzite Countertops work best in simple kitchens. The tone stays cool without being cold, and the patterns aren't too busy. It's one of those options that just quietly fits without needing attention.
